Skip to content

Feature: Preset selections for custom made workflows #1549

@Marcusk19

Description

@Marcusk19

🚀 Feature Description

Our team has now created several custom workflows. I'm finding it a source of friction to now go fill out the custom workflow form whenever I want to use a specific workflow

It would be great if we could add other workflow "sources" which allows us to select from a drop down of workflows like the default selection:

Image

💡 Proposed Solution

I'd like to suggest a setting in our ambient workspace that allows us to add different workflow sources. they then show up on the drop down list.

It would also be helpful to perhaps create a tab section so you can switch between viewing default workflows vs custom ones that come from a different source. We store all our ambient workflow definitions in a central git repo at the moment.

🎯 Use Cases

Teams that invest heavily in custom workflows

User Stories:

  • As a user, I want to be able to quickly start a session with a custom workflow

🔧 Technical Considerations

Unsure about these at the moment, to me this sounds like it should only be a frontend change..

📊 Success Metrics

User can easily select pre-existing ambient workflows without filling out git repo, branch, directory every time

🔄 Alternatives Considered

N/A

✅ Acceptance Criteria

  • Feature requirements clearly defined
  • Technical design reviewed and approved
  • Implementation completed and tested
  • Documentation updated
  • User acceptance testing passed
  • Feature flag implemented (if applicable)

🏷️ Labels

  • Priority: [low/medium/high]
  • Effort: [S/M/L/XL]
  • Component: [frontend/backend/operator/tools/docs]
  • Type: [new-feature/enhancement/improvement]

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ions